HELP! How Many Watts on my GK?
 
I just bought a used GK 412 gs and have no idea how many watts it is. I know it's 8/16 ohms, but other than that, I can't even find on the internet that GK 4x12 ever existed. Please help. I know someone on here knows what this is. Thank you kindly!

B-string 02-24-2013 06:59 PM

Well I can tell you it is a stereo guitar cab! IIRC it was rated at 150 watts per pair (300 total) for guitar.

basscooker 02-24-2013 07:23 PM

guitar cab

i wouldn't put anything over 100 watts into it, and i'd start looking for a different cab. it wont last long.
